Altitude Test Chambers are specialized environmental testing enclosures designed to simulate high-altitude, low-pressure conditions to evaluate product performance, durability, and safety under extreme atmospheric variations. They are widely used in aerospace, defense, automotive, electronics, and material testing applications to ensure compliance with international standards such as MIL-STD, IEC, and ISO.Core Functions and Purpose
